Evaluating Morepro Heart Rate Tracker Accuracy Analysis

To determine how accurate the Morepro heart rate monitor truly is, we executed a thorough test. Our procedure involved contrasting its data against a clinical electrocardiogram (ECG) – considered the gold standard – during various types of physical exertion, including rest to moderate jogging. The data were quite close, showing minimal general error of under five beats per minute. While slight variations did occur, particularly during rapid segments, typically, the Morepro appears to provide a reliable indication of one's heart rate.
